Business Development Manager - Description
As a Business Development Manager at Peter Igel Foods, you will play a critical role in continuously identifying new Retail & Food Service sales opportunities and helping to achieve our revenue goals. In this role, you will be largely responsible for planning and executing sales at our existing customers as well as developing new markets, both in Retail and Food Service for us in Canada and the US. Product ideation, sourcing and procurement will also be part of your role, helping our clients expand their private label product portfolios. Additionally, you will have account management responsibilities ensuring our customers are always getting the best value from their relationship with us. You will be a critical member of our Sales team as we continue our organic growth. Responsibilities & Duties:
Create and implement strategic sales plans that successfully achieve business objectives
Develop and maintain positive relationships with key clients, including negotiating and closing on major contracts
Secure new customers and categories for growth.
Use available data to accurately forecast sales and set appropriate performance goals
Influence & support company Values
Participate in meetings and prepare weekly sales tracking reports.
Foster positive vendor and seller relationships
Qualifications/Skills
Bachelor’s degree in Sales, Business Administration, Marketing or equivalent experience
Minimum five years’ sales experience selling to a Retailer at Head Office level - existing client base an asset
International experience is a definite asset
Excellent written and verbal communication skills, including the ability to present strategy and results to staff members at every level of the organization
Excellent MS Office skills required, especially Excel and PowerPoint
An absolute customer obsession with the ability to create and maintain positive relationships with current and prospective clients
Demonstrated skill in negotiating and closing on critical sales contracts
Business savvy with an entrepreneurial mind set
Ability to work independently as well as cooperatively in a strong team environment
Positive attitude, energetic, passionate and driven to succeed
